What is J-hope IN THE BOX about? 
"j-hope IN THE BOX" is a documentary that follows the journey of the first Korean musician to headline the main stage of the world's largest music festival, "Lollapalooza," in Chicago. The film captures 200 days of the artist's daily life, from the production of his solo album "Jack in the Box" to his debut on the stage of "Lollapalooza." As he faces anxiety about his identity as a solo artist, j-hope takes a leap of faith and prepares to introduce himself to the world. The documentary features flashing lights sequences or patterns that may affect photosensitive viewers.
